What is Copyright?
Copyright is a legal right given to the creator or owner of original work. It helps protect creative expression such as writing, art, music, software, videos, films, designs, and other original content.
In India, copyright applications can be filed online through the official Copyright Office portal using Form XIV.

Documents Required

For Individual / Proprietor

Applicant ID proof

Applicant address proof

Title and description of the work

Soft copy of the work

For software, source code copies may be required as per filing rules.

Author details

Owner details, if different from author

NOC from author, publisher, or other parties, if applicable

Power of Attorney, if filed through a representative
Copyright Registration Process

Step 1 — Consultation
We understand your creative work, ownership details, category, and registration requirement.
Step 2 — Document Collection
We collect the required documents, work copy, author details, and owner information.
Step 3 — Application Preparation
The application is prepared with Form XIV, Statement of Particulars, and required supporting details.
Step 4 — Online Filing
The application and documents are submitted through the official copyright registration process.
Step 5 — Diary Number
After filing, a diary number is generated for tracking the application.
Step 6 — Examination & Objection Handling
The application is reviewed. If any objection or clarification is raised, a suitable reply may be required.
Step 7 — Registration Certificate
After successful review, the copyright registration is recorded and the certificate is issued.
